MCQ
$\sec70^\circ\sin20^\circ+\cos20^\circ\text{cosec}70^\circ=?$
  • A
    0
  • B
    1
  • C
    -1
  • 2

Answer

Correct option: D.
2
$\sec70^\circ\sin20^\circ+\cos20^\circ\text{cosec}70^\circ$
$=\frac{1}{\cos70^\circ}\times\sin20^\circ+\cos20^\circ\times\frac{1}{\sin70^\circ}$
$=\frac{1}{\cos(90^\circ-20^\circ)}\times\sin20^\circ+\cos20^\circ\times\frac{1}{\sin(90^\circ-20^\circ)}$
$=\frac{1}{\sin20^\circ}\times\sin20^\circ+\cos20^\circ\times\frac{1}{\cos20^\circ}$
$=1+1$
$=2$
